About NYES HR
North Yorkshire Education Services (NYES) HR is one of a number of traded services for Education settings, within and beyond North Yorkshire. As a service which is 100% funded by education clients opting to buy into our service, we rely on each and every member of our team to have a highly commercial and professional approach. The world of Education is rapidly changing presenting challenge and opportunity in equal measure. We are proud to be a responsive and solution focused service providing a high standard of professional HR Advisory support to over 400 educational settings. Our customers include maintained schools, Academies, Multi Academy Trusts and Independent Schools predominantly across the North of England with our income being 100% reliant on our customers choosing to buy into the provision. As such, our practitioners need to have excellent commercial awareness; customer service and strong relationships are key to our success.
The team sits as part of North Yorkshire Council’s high performing HR and OD Service and we are very proud to have recently won the 2025 PPMA Public Sector HR and OD Team of the Year, the PPMA Gold award as well as a recent award for HR and Payroll provider of the year from Education Today.
What you will be doing…
Due to the promotion of a valued member of our team to an HR Director position, we currently have an excellent opportunity for an experienced HR practitioner to join us as an HR Business Partner. This role is truly varied, challenging and rewarding; you will act as the strategic HR partner for a portfolio of our largest Multi Academy Trusts to support them to deliver their HR priorities, often seen as an extended member of their senior management teams. Your job is to partner with them to understand their individual context, culture, terms and conditions and policies in order to ensure that they receive a tailored service relative to their organisational needs. You need to be able to operate at a strategic level with a high level of credibility, advising CEOs, Trustees, Chief Operating Officers and other senior professionals as well as manage a complex employee relations caseload and day to day supervision of HR Advisers. Your casework will include the most complex operational cases including safeguarding allegations, advising appeal panels and at times you will provide an expert commissioned investigatory service. Given the highly autonomous, commercial and specialist nature of the role, we are ideally looking for an existing HRBP with public sector experience and experience of education would be advantageous.
